What will you learn in the Sport Management course?

By attending the Sport Management course, you will learn to manage and enhance sports organizations or individual athletes, not only by establishing relationships with financiers, sponsors, and institutions but also by developing communication strategies and managing the digital presence of sports entities.

The course covers topics such as:

  • Sports organization management
  • Sponsorship acquisition and management
  • Digital communication strategies
  • Event planning and management
  • Fan engagement and experience
  • Professional English for international communication

The program includes hands-on projects and internships with sports organizations, allowing you to apply your skills in real-world settings and build a professional network in the sports industry.


How is the Sport Management course structured?

Our teaching methodology is experiential, focusing on active participation in lessons and activities. We strongly promote interaction among students, as well as between students and instructors, guest speakers, and industry professionals. This approach fosters innovative ways to discover and acquire knowledge.

In addition to the core curriculum, the course includes English lessons essential for engaging with international partners and sponsors.

What are the career opportunities?

The ITS Sport Management course prepares you to enter the workforce immediately, with opportunities to pursue various roles in the sports industry, such as:

  • Sports Manager
  • Team Manager
  • Event Coordinator
  • Sponsorship Manager
  • Fan Engagement Specialist

Who is the ITS Sport Management course for?

The course is open to young individuals who wish to acquire practical and specialized skills, holding one of the following qualifications:

  • High school diploma
  • IFTS diploma (Technical and Higher Education and Training)
  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ree, even if in progress

No prior knowledge is required; the training starts from the basics.

Course accreditation

The courses are accredited and funded by MIUR, the Lombardy Region, and the European Social Fund. Thanks to investments from these entities, our innovative approach, and an efficient organizational structure, we maintain affordable costs, significantly lower than traditional university programs.
